Event Details
What happens when freedom of expression comes under threat? In frank and wide-ranging interviews, historian and critic Leonard S. Marcus probes the experience of thirteen leading authors of books for young people in You Can’t Say That!: Writers for Young People Talk About Censorship, Free Expression, and the Stories They Have To Tell. For this program, Marcus is joined by Meg Medina, one of the writers featured in the book, to discuss the interviews, compiling them together, and the themes of the book.
